How Dance Sparks Creativity in Young Minds

Dance is a beautiful blend of discipline and imagination. Every movement tells a story, and every rhythm inspires a new form of expression. Through dance, children learn how to think creatively  whether they’re choreographing a small sequence or experimenting with new styles. It helps them translate emotions into motion, stimulating both sides of the brain. Kids who engage in creative movement early in life often develop better problem-solving skills, flexibility in thinking, and a vivid imagination.

Moreover, dance encourages individuality. No two dancers interpret music the same way, which teaches children that their unique way of expressing themselves is valuable and worth celebrating.

Social and Emotional Benefits of Dance

Beyond physical coordination, dance nurtures emotional intelligence. In group dance sessions, kids learn cooperation, teamwork, and empathy. They must listen to instructions, coordinate with others, and adapt to group dynamics skills that are vital in every aspect of life.

Dance also provides a healthy emotional outlet. Children can express happiness, excitement, or even frustration through movement, which helps them manage emotions constructively. Encouragement and positive feedback from teachers and peers further reinforce their self-worth and motivation to improve.

How Parents Can Support Their Child’s Dance Journey

Parents play a vital role in sustaining their child’s passion for dance. The best support is encouragement without pressure  celebrating progress rather than perfection. Simple actions like attending performances, practicing routines at home, or playing upbeat music for fun family dance sessions can keep the spark alive.

Additionally, allowing kids to choose the dance style that excites them most fosters autonomy and long-term commitment. When children feel ownership over their creative choices, their confidence naturally grows.
